NEWLY ENLISTED CONFEDERATE CAVALRYMAN

This fellow has likely just signed up in a local cavalry unit and has not yet gotten a uniform, but has taken his saber to the photographer for a portrait before going off to war. He is bareheaded, has a narrow chin beard, and wears a double-breasted coat, likely a civilian garment whose buttons the photographer has militarized by adding a touch of gold. He holds the hilt of a cavalry saber forward, however, to make clear he has joined the army. The photographer lightly gilded the brass guard and pommel cap of the saber also, but the black leather grip shows plainly. A simple roller buckle on the waist belt clearly points to a southern origin, as does the shoulder support belt, which uses a snap hook of some sort, though they may have turned the belt upside down and rearranged the long sling to create the proper orientation of gear for the image.

The photo is a ninth-plate tintype housed in a figural thermoplastic case with floral motifs and a Littlefield, Parsons & Co. advertising liner in the back. The facing pad, glass, mat and frame are in place. This nicely shows the first steps in the making of a southern cavalry trooper who dominated his northern counterparts for at least the first two years of the war.  [sr][ph:m]
